History

B.J. Kosmos was a film producer who was famous for the hit movie "The Nameless Thing From the Black Lagoon in the Murky Swamp!". He once made a Viking movie in which Thor played a part.[1] He was approached by the Green Goblin to make a film with Spider-Man - actually just a ruse to lure Spider-Man into a trap.[2]
